Action Feed Systems has garnered a much sought after contract to provide multiple feed systems for the automotive industry This equipment is designed to provide seemless transition from bulk storage to insertion of plastic weatherstrip retainers (door weatherstripping) used on the 2003 Honda Accord

A local automation integrator chose AFS from a stable of suppliers in the burgeoning part feeding industry located in the Rockford, Illinois metro area (AFS is located in Machesney Park, Illinois, a northeast 'suburb' of Rockford), an area some say is second only to Indianapolis in the number of skilled craftsmen devoted to the part feeding for automation industry.

This order consists of the following installed components: vibratory feed bowl, variable controller, gravity track, escapement, mounting plate and CAD layout.

Each unit of this multiple order will be integrated into the larger insertion system mentioned above.

At a time when every purchase is viewed and reviewed, AFS was chosen for a number of considerations.

Of course a competive quote being a given, successful experience on five previous feed systems with very similar part geometry seemed to be the deciding factor in the choice.
